Developer of satellite-based communication services. It provides users with a platform that develops small-sized, low-cost telecommunication satellites in the geostationary orbit and in a fixed location. It can provide internet connectivity as soon as the satellite is launched to rural areas and indigenous communities.
Developer of space systems, components, spacecraft, propulsion, and related technologies. The company provides solutions for commercial spaceflight, national security, and microgravity research. Offerings include spaceplanes, space station habitats, electrical power systems, and environmental control systems. The company also provides hardware, testing, and analysis services.
Developer of AI-powered platforms and software for defense applications. The company provides solutions for mission autonomy, surveillance, and object detection. Its offerings include autonomous pilot software, command and control toolkits, and autonomy development platforms. It also manufactures unmanned aircraft for int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ance missions.

Developer of satellite-based geographic monitoring and communication solutions. It provides users with a constellation of small satellites in low Earth orbit, to generate reports on wireless signals that can be used to track and monitor global transportation networks, assist with emergencies, and provide other data analytics services to various industries. Provider of space-based data, analytics, and space services using a large nanosatellite constellation in low orbit. The company collects and processes radio-frequency and atmospheric signals to deliver actionable insights for weather and climate, aviation, maritime, government, and security use cases, including RF geolocation, flight tracking, ship tracking, and greenhouse gas monitoring. Developer of commercial space stations for habitation. Its space stations can host microgravity experiments and space-environment materials testing. It is also developing a thruster that can be installed on a mobile propulsion test stand. It also caters to government astronauts, tourists, private companies, and individuals for research, manufacturing, space exploration system testing and tourism.
